Seasons of doubt, discouragement, and spiritual dryness are not unusual in the Christian life. From the laments of the Psalms to the struggles of Christians throughout church history, even the most faithful believers have known times when God feels distant.
This seminar explores how we can walk wisely and compassionately with those experiencing spiritual crisis. Rooted in the hope of the gospel, we’ll consider common causes of doubt and discouragement, and reflect on how to respond with patient, Christ-like care to friends, family, or church members in need.
Whether you’re involved in pastoral care, youth ministry, or simply want to support someone you care about through a difficult season, this seminar will help you to offer the hope of Christ to those who are struggling.
